Which is more significant to American history… the frontier… or the cities? Defend your answer with specific evidence, and address the opposing viewpoint.

The frontier.
The frontier established all things first and foremost. Cities developed around the development of frontier establishments. Cities depended on the raw goods that were most often harvested from the frontier or unsettled rural areas. As a specific example, the frontier provided what would become a major industry in the city of Chicago, the cattle industry. Animals were raised in the prairie states, shipped to Chicago for processing and distributed to the East, slaughterhouses made Chicago, built on a product of the frontier. The cities depended on the raw goods and resources to be built. And again, the only way major cities were settled, were first by being frontier encampments.
